{{alias}}( x, predicate[, thisArg] ) Cumulatively tests whether at least one element in a provided array passes a test implemented by a predicate function. The predicate function is provided three arguments: - value: current array element. - index: current array element index. - arr: the input array. Parameters ---------- x: ArrayLikeObject Input array. predicate: Function Predicate function. thisArg: any (optional) Execution context. Returns ------- out: Array Output array. Examples -------- > function f( v ) { return ( v > 0 ); }; > var x = [ 0, 0, 0, 1, 0 ]; > var out = {{alias}}( x, f ) [ false, false, false, true, true ] {{alias}}.assign( x, y, stride, offset, predicate[, thisArg] ) Cumulatively tests whether at least one element in a provided array passes a test implemented by a predicate function and assigns results to a provided output array. Parameters ---------- x: ArrayLikeObject Input array. y: ArrayLikeObject Output array. stride: integer Output array stride. offset: integer Output array offset. predicate: Function Predicate function. thisArg: any (optional) Execution context. Returns ------- y: ArrayLikeObject Output array. Examples -------- > function f( v ) { return ( v > 0 ); }; > var x = [ 0, 0, 0, 1, 0 ]; > var y = [ false, null, false, null, false, null, false, null, false ]; > var result = {{alias}}.assign( x, y, 2, 0, f ) [ false, null, false, null, false, null, true, null, true ] See Also --------
